Recently, there's been a lot of discussion here about the history and meanings of names - indeed, the "made up name" issue appears to have again reared its head in the post below me! I know that there has also been some frustration within the community among members who feel their more traditionally-based criticisms are not being heard, or who feel their attempts to discuss etymology have been wasted.
I talked it over with
a_green_faerie, and decided to start a community:
namingnames. This new community is meant to be a sort of supplement to
baby_names, in my mind. We will discuss the history and etymology of names, various associations, famous bearers, meanings, parallel occurrences in other languages, etc. etc. It will also be fine to post a list of your favorite names for discussion, or just one name you heard recently, or interesting family names, or whatever. The only up-front requirements are that you keep discussion honest (the phrase "not my style" is outlawed), and that you accept criticism gracefully. Keep in mind that in a community about etymology and historical use, Maddissyn Seth for a girl is going to garner some criticism.
This community will not be for everyone, I realize. Some people find this sort of thing boring, and some people don't really care whether a name is newly-minted or meant for the opposite sex or whatever. But for others, hopefully
namingnames will be a place to bring discussion they don't feel they've really been having in
baby_names. It's not exactly a sister community, but it's meant to be just a fun addition to our regularly scheduled baby names programming!
